Obstetrics and Gynaecology

The Department of Obstetrics &Gynecology is the largest department in Safdarjung Hospital, dealing with more than 30% of the total admissions of the hospital, and providing comprehensive medical care for safe motherhood, population stabilization and protection of women’s health in all stages of their life. Besides Delhi, our department caters to all women coming from all districts of the National Capital region and also gets referred patients from the neighboring states. As in the present scenario Govt. of India is focusing on institutional deliveries, our hospital is one of the busiest hospitals in India catering to a large number of high risk obstetrics patients with number of deliveries reaching almost 25000 per year. 
The Department of Obstetrics and Gynecology offers a broad range of inpatient and outpatient services for women including high risk obstetrical care, infertility services for women, routine obstetrics, reproductive endocrinology, gynecological oncology, Uro- gynecology, fetal medicine and comprehensive diagnosis and treatment of routine gynecological disorders. 
There are a total of 355 beds (279 obstetric beds distributed in six wards and 76 gynecology beds distributed in three wards & 15 in HDU/CCU), two labour rooms, and two nurseries for intensive neonatal care, and emergency and el ective operation theatres with facilities for major and minor obstetric and gynecological surgery. Fifteen bedded Obstetrical critical care unit was inaugurated in 12th February, 2016.The Department also has IVF centre where all Infertility Services, IUI/IVF is being done including ICSI. The department also has a subspeciality of Fetal Medicine and Genetic clinic which offers outpatient services, genetic counselling and all fetal invasive diagnostic and therapeutic procedures. It also runs the NEEV clinic which caters to preconception and premarital counselling and screening services. The department is equipped with specialized staff, modern equipment and high technologies of diagnosis and care in Gynecology and Obstetrics. We are able to perform complicated and innovative surgeries and provide quality care to patients. Our hospital is also known for the quality of its training to resident doctors and health workers. State-of-the-art Daksh lab in the department imparts basic and emergency Obstetrical skills to health professionals from different parts of India.

The Outpatient services are provided daily on the 1st floor of the new OPD block. OPD services include ANC, Gynae, Infertility Clinic, Family Planning Services and various Special Clinics Services . 
There is a separate Casualty (GRR- Gynae Recovery Room) of Obstetrics &Gynaecology department which provides round-the-clockemergency services. 
The Maternity Block for indoor services is located at the entrance of gate no. 5 of the hospital on main Ring road. A 24x7 registration counter for facilitating admissions in Obst & Gynae is provided at the entrance of Maternity Block. 
The Department is 365 bedded (Obst & Gynae) housed in 09 Wards along with 2 Labour Rooms (LRs) + 02 Operation Theaters (OTs) + 01 HDU + 01 GRR + 01 IVF Centre.

Family Welfare Services:

  • It is an integral part of this department
  • Daily OPD services from 9.00AM to 1.00 PM
  • Counselling and provision of contraceptive services
  • Laparoscopic, minilap tubal ligations and postpartum ligations are done daily on day care basis.
  • Male family welfare clinic with provision for non- scalpel vasectomy (NSV) services provided daily on day care basis

Indoor services

  • Indoor Services are provided in the obstetrics and gynae wards
  • Routine and specialised antenatal and postnatal care is imparted
  • Each obstetric ward has one CTG machine for fetal monitoring
  • Deliveries are conducted in two labour rooms
  • Labour rooms are equipped with one ultrasound machine available round the clock and one CTG machine
  • Ultrasound Doppler machine for in-patient assessment
  • In Gynaecological wards patients with gynaecological ailments are managed
  • Patients following surgery & high risk cases are kept in post operative ward (presently in ward 2)
